In spring there's Vermont Maple Syrup (made just out back), Apple blossoms, and Lilac festivals. Summer brings lazy days at the multitude of area Lakes, hiking the Green Mountains, or exploring the hidden hamlets in search of that rare antique. (There's also plenty of 'Ben & Jerry's' ice cream at the local factory in Waterbury !). Fall brings out nature's palette of rich colors, sweet harvest, and whiff of wood smoke from the cook stove. Winter is full of the best skiing in the East (both Nordic and Alpine) and long cozy nights curled up by the fieldstone fireplace. X-country skiers will enjoy Vermont's premier destination, 'Craftsbury Nordic Center' with miles of trails and of course, 'THE' Marathon.
Downhill skiers have as many choices as days in the week !! Stowe, Mount Mansfield, Smugglers notch, Jay Peak, Burke Mountain, Sugarbush, Mad River Glen, Bolton Valley ..... The list goes on, all from 45 min. to an hour and a half away. For snowmobilers, the VAST trail system starts here !
